+#include "ec_commands.h"
+#include "gpio.h"
+#include "led_common.h"
+#include "led_onoff_states.h"
+#include "chipset.h"
+#include "driver/bc12/mt6360.h"
+
+const int led_charge_lvl_1 = 5;
+const int led_charge_lvl_2 = 95;
+
+struct led_descriptor led_bat_state_table[LED_NUM_STATES][LED_NUM_PHASES] = {
+ [STATE_CHARGING_LVL_1] = {{EC_LED_COLOR_AMBER, LED_INDEFINITE} },
+ [STATE_CHARGING_LVL_2] = {{EC_LED_COLOR_AMBER, LED_INDEFINITE} },
+ [STATE_CHARGING_FULL_CHARGE] = {{EC_LED_COLOR_WHITE, LED_INDEFINITE} },
+ [STATE_DISCHARGE_S0] = {{LED_OFF, LED_INDEFINITE} },
+ [STATE_DISCHARGE_S0_BAT_LOW] = {{EC_LED_COLOR_AMBER, 1 * LED_ONE_SEC},
+ {LED_OFF, 3 * LED_ONE_SEC} },
+ [STATE_DISCHARGE_S3] = {{LED_OFF, LED_INDEFINITE} },
+ [STATE_DISCHARGE_S5] = {{LED_OFF, LED_INDEFINITE} },
+ [STATE_BATTERY_ERROR] = {{EC_LED_COLOR_AMBER, 1 * LED_ONE_SEC},
+ {LED_OFF, 1 * LED_ONE_SEC} },
+ [STATE_FACTORY_TEST] = {{EC_LED_COLOR_WHITE, 2 * LED_ONE_SEC},
+ {EC_LED_COLOR_AMBER, 2 * LED_ONE_SEC} },
+};
+
+const struct led_descriptor
+ led_pwr_state_table[PWR_LED_NUM_STATES][LED_NUM_PHASES] = {
+ [PWR_LED_STATE_ON] = {{EC_LED_COLOR_WHITE, LED_INDEFINITE} },
+ [PWR_LED_STATE_SUSPEND_AC] = {{EC_LED_COLOR_WHITE, 1 * LED_ONE_SEC},
+ {LED_OFF, 3 * LED_ONE_SEC} },
+ [PWR_LED_STATE_SUSPEND_NO_AC] = {{EC_LED_COLOR_WHITE, 1 * LED_ONE_SEC},
+ {LED_OFF, 3 * LED_ONE_SEC} },
+ [PWR_LED_STATE_OFF] = {{LED_OFF, LED_INDEFINITE} },
+};
+
+
+const enum ec_led_id supported_led_ids[] = {
+ EC_LED_ID_BATTERY_LED,
+ EC_LED_ID_POWER_LED,
+};
+
+const int supported_led_ids_count = ARRAY_SIZE(supported_led_ids);
+
+void led_set_color_battery(enum ec_led_colors color)
+{
+ mt6360_led_set_brightness(MT6360_LED_RGB2, 50);
+ mt6360_led_set_brightness(MT6360_LED_RGB3, 50);
+
+ switch (color) {
+ case EC_LED_COLOR_AMBER:
+ mt6360_led_enable(MT6360_LED_RGB2, 0);
+ mt6360_led_enable(MT6360_LED_RGB3, 1);
+ break;
+ case EC_LED_COLOR_WHITE:
+ mt6360_led_enable(MT6360_LED_RGB2, 1);
+ mt6360_led_enable(MT6360_LED_RGB3, 0);
+ break;
+ default: /* LED_OFF and other unsupported colors */
+ mt6360_led_enable(MT6360_LED_RGB2, 0);
+ mt6360_led_enable(MT6360_LED_RGB3, 0);
+ break;
+ }
+}
+
+void led_set_color_power(enum ec_led_colors color)
+{
+ mt6360_led_set_brightness(MT6360_LED_RGB1, 1);
+ mt6360_led_enable(MT6360_LED_RGB1, color == EC_LED_COLOR_WHITE);
+}
+
+void led_get_brightness_range(enum ec_led_id led_id, uint8_t *brightness_range)
+{
+ if (led_id == EC_LED_ID_BATTERY_LED) {
+ brightness_range[EC_LED_COLOR_AMBER] =
+ MT6360_LED_BRIGHTNESS_MAX;
+ brightness_range[EC_LED_COLOR_WHITE] =
+ MT6360_LED_BRIGHTNESS_MAX;
+ } else if (led_id == EC_LED_ID_POWER_LED) {
+ brightness_range[EC_LED_COLOR_WHITE] =
+ MT6360_LED_BRIGHTNESS_MAX;
+ }
+}
+
+int led_set_brightness(enum ec_led_id led_id, const uint8_t *brightness)
+{
+ if (led_id == EC_LED_ID_BATTERY_LED) {
+ if (brightness[EC_LED_COLOR_AMBER] != 0)
+ led_set_color_battery(EC_LED_COLOR_AMBER);
+ else if (brightness[EC_LED_COLOR_WHITE] != 0)
+ led_set_color_battery(EC_LED_COLOR_WHITE);
+ else
+ led_set_color_battery(LED_OFF);
+ } else if (led_id == EC_LED_ID_POWER_LED) {
+ if (brightness[EC_LED_COLOR_WHITE] != 0)
+ led_set_color_power(EC_LED_COLOR_WHITE);
+ else
+ led_set_color_power(LED_OFF);
+ }
+
+ return EC_SUCCESS;
+}
+
+__override enum led_states board_led_get_state(enum led_states desired_state)
+{
+ if (desired_state == STATE_BATTERY_ERROR) {
+ if (chipset_in_state(CHIPSET_STATE_ON))
+ return desired_state;
+ else if (chipset_in_state(CHIPSET_STATE_ANY_SUSPEND))
+ return STATE_DISCHARGE_S3;
+ else
+ return STATE_DISCHARGE_S5;
+ }
+ return desired_state;
+}
